Carthen
Red, yellow, white, orange carthen. Warp fringe. Side selfedge. An example of the work of W. E. Morris, Esgair Moel woollen mill, Welsh Folk Museum.
Pattern based on a carthen in the collection from the Lampeter district, Cardiganshire (29.210.1). Large check design consisting of blue and red bands 3¼" broad intersecting to give rectangles approx 10" x 8½" on red background; within this pattern there are geometrical designs in white and golden brown. On the reverse side, the background is in golden brown. No fringe.
